Hyundai Ioniq Design

2021 Hyundai Ioniq EV has come out with their newest model, the Ioniq. This car is unique because it is available in three different types of fuel: electric, hybrid, and plug-in hybrid. The Ioniq also has a very sleek and efficient design that makes it stand out from other cars on the market.

Hyundai Ioniq Performance

Hyundai Ioniq Electric is quickly becoming a popular choice for drivers looking for an efficient and affordable electric car. But what many people don’t know is that the Ioniq also offers great performance, beating out most of its competitors in its class. The Ioniq can go from 0 to 60 in just 8.9 seconds, making it one of the quickest electric cars on the market. It also has a top speed of 115 miles per hour, which is impressive for a car that gets such good gas mileage.

Hyundai Ioniq Safety

The 2023 Hyundai Ioniq is a new electric car that offers superior safety features. The car has a five-star safety rating from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, which is the highest rating possible. Some of the car’s safety features include lane departure warning, blind-spot detection, and rear cross-traffic alert. These features help to keep drivers safe while driving and reduce the risk of accidents.
